Understanding Commercial Engineering Services: What They Do and Why They Matter

Commercial engineering encompasses a broad range of disciplines essential for bringing commercial and industrial projects to life. At its core, it includes:

  • Design & Engineering Solutions: Creating detailed plans and specifications for buildings, incorporating structural integrity, functional design, and regulatory compliance.
  • Civil Engineering Expertise: Ensuring the project’s foundation, drainage, roads, and other infrastructure meet industry standards.
  • Structural Engineering Consulting: Analyzing building structures to withstand loads, winds, earthquakes, and other potential stresses.
  • Commercial Construction Management: Overseeing the entire construction process, from pre-construction planning to final delivery.

Effective commercial engineering services integrate these disciplines seamlessly, ensuring your project is not just completed on time and within budget but also meets all safety and quality benchmarks.

Key Factors in Choosing Commercial Engineering Services

Selecting the right engineers for your project involves a careful evaluation of several critical factors:

1. Expertise and Experience:

  • Specialization: Different projects require diverse skill sets. Identify your project’s specific needs, whether it’s a mixed-use development, office building, retail space, or industrial facility. Choose engineers with proven experience in that sector.
  • Track Record: Ask for references and review past projects. Success stories and satisfied clients are a testament to the engineer’s capability and reliability.
  • Industry Certifications: Look for engineers with relevant professional certifications (e.g., PE for Professional Engineer) demonstrating their commitment to excellence and ongoing education.

2. Project Scope and Size:

  • Complex vs. Standard Projects: For intricate, large-scale projects, you may need a team of specialized engineers. Smaller, more straightforward projects might suffice with a single engineer or a smaller firm.
  • Growth Potential: Consider potential future expansions or modifications. Engineers who understand your long-term vision can incorporate adaptable designs and efficient systems from the outset.

3. Communication and Collaboration:

  • Open Communication: Effective engineers should foster open, transparent communication throughout the project lifecycle. Regular updates, clear explanations, and willingness to address concerns are vital.
  • Collaboration with Other Professionals: Commercial engineering services often involve collaboration with architects, contractors, and other stakeholders. Ensure your chosen engineers have a proven track record of teamwork and can coordinate effectively.

4. Cost and Budget:

  • Competitive Pricing: Obtain quotes from several firms to ensure you’re getting fair, competitive pricing. However, don’t solely focus on cost; balance it with quality and expertise.
  • Value for Money: Consider the overall value engineers bring to your project, including their experience, methodology, and the potential for innovation that could reduce long-term operating costs.

5. Regulatory Compliance and Safety Standards:

  • Local Codes and Regulations: Engineers should be well-versed in local building codes, zoning regulations, and safety standards specific to your region.
  • Safety Culture: A strong commitment to workplace safety is non-negotiable. Enquire about their safety protocols and training programs.

Selecting the Right Engineer for Your Specific Needs

1. Architectural Designers vs. Structural Engineers:

While architectural designers create the aesthetics, structural engineers focus on the building’s skeleton and load-bearing capacity. For complex structures, both are crucial. Ensure your chosen engineer(s) can handle both aspects or understand how their specialties complement each other in your project.

2. Civil vs. Structural Engineering:

For most commercial projects, structural engineering is a key component. However, depending on the scale and nature of your construction, you might require civil engineering expertise for site development, drainage systems, roads, and other infrastructure.

3. Specialized Services:

Some engineers specialize in specific areas like sustainable design, energy efficiency, or technology integration. If these elements are core to your project vision, seek out engineers with relevant experience.

The Project Lifecycle: When to Engage Commercial Engineering Services

Choosing the right engineer is only part of the equation. Understanding the appropriate engagement points throughout the project lifecycle ensures smooth collaboration and successful outcomes:

  • Pre-Design Phase: Consult with engineers early in the planning stage for initial site assessments, concept design, and feasibility studies.
  • Design Phase: This is when detailed engineering designs are created. It’s crucial to work closely with engineers during this phase to ensure your vision aligns with structural integrity and regulatory requirements.
  • Construction Phase: Engineers play a pivotal role in construction management, overseeing implementation, quality control, and addressing any design or technical issues that arise.
  • Post-Occupancy: Even after completion, engineers can assist with facility maintenance, repairs, and potential modifications.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. How do I know if I need a team of engineers or just one?

    • The size and complexity of your project determine this. Smaller, simpler projects may only require a single engineer, while larger, more intricate ones benefit from specialized teams.
  2. What questions should I ask during interviews with potential engineering firms?

    • Ask about their experience, methodology, communication approach, understanding of your project’s specific needs, and how they handle budget overruns or unexpected challenges.
  3. How do I ensure my chosen engineers adhere to safety standards?

    • Engineers should be knowledgeable about local building codes and regulations, maintain a strong safety culture within their practice, and provide evidence of regular training in workplace safety protocols.
  4. Can an engineer assist with project budgeting and cost control?

    • Absolutely! Many commercial engineering firms offer budgetary assistance, helping you create accurate initial estimates and monitoring costs throughout construction to ensure compliance with your budget.
  5. What happens if I have concerns or disagreements during the project?

    • Open communication is key. Discuss any issues promptly, clearly, and respectfully. A good engineer will listen to your concerns, provide solutions, and work collaboratively to resolve conflicts.
